Career path

The career advancement programme in cybersecurity for small business managers focuses on essential response planning roles to protect their organizations from ever-evolving threats. The demand for these roles is rising, as indicated by the 3D pie chart below: 1. **Cybersecurity Analyst**: These professionals play a critical role in monitoring networks, identifying vulnerabilities, and mitigating cyberattacks. With an average salary of £45,000 - £70,000 in the UK, the demand for cybersecurity analysts is expected to grow by 25% by 2026. 2. **Security Consultant**: Security consultants help businesses design and implement robust cybersecurity strategies and policies. They earn an average salary of £50,000 - £100,000, and the job market is projected to increase by 15% in the next few years. 3. **Network Security Engineer**: These professionals focus on securing an organization's networks, implementing security measures, and troubleshooting issues. With an average salary ranging from £40,000 to £70,000, the demand for network security engineers is expected to rise by 10% by 2026. 4. **SOC Analyst**: Security Operations Center (SOC) analysts monitor systems for security breaches and respond to incidents. They earn between £30,000 and £60,000, and the job market is projected to grow by 12% in the coming years. 5. **Cybersecurity Manager**: These professionals oversee the entire cybersecurity function, including strategy, implementation, and incident response. Cybersecurity managers earn an average salary of £60,000 - £120,000, and the job market is expected to grow by 10% by 2026. These roles are essential for small businesses to protect themselves from cyber threats and maintain their competitive edge. As the demand for these roles continues to grow, professionals with the right skills can enjoy a rewarding career in cybersecurity.
